Anomalous Coffee Machine is a surreal, interactive visual novel/simulation game where you operate a vending machine capable of producing any drink you can imagine—from a standard latte to reality-bending paradoxes. It is highly regarded by the community for its eerie atmosphere and creative "type-to-generate" mechanics. Game Overview

The Concept: You stand before a mysterious girl and a coffee machine. You must type in drinks for her to sample. The game tests the limits of your imagination, responding to realistic, impossible, or even lethal inputs.

Playtime: A standard playthrough of the main story takes about 5 hours, while completionists seeking every bizarre outcome can expect around 15 hours of gameplay, according to data from HowLongToBeat.

Tone & Atmosphere: The game is noted for its "lo-fi" aesthetic and unsettling vibes. The interaction with the girl is the core of the experience, as her reactions shift based on the "anomalies" you serve her. Community Consensus Anomalous Coffee Machine.zip

Creative Freedom: Reviewers on Steam highlight the freedom to experiment with text inputs as the game's strongest feature.

(and its sequel), developed by Ame. It is a psychological horror simulation where players interact with a vending machine capable of producing any substance imaginable based on text input. Subject Overview: Anomalous Coffee Machine

The "Anomalous Coffee Machine" is presented as a visual novel and interactive simulator. The narrative revolves around a mysterious girl who demands the player use the machine to serve her drinks.

Core Mechanic: A text-parser system where you type the name of a drink or concept (e.g., "Latte," "Liquid Gold," or "Fear"). The machine then attempts to synthesize it.
